Sort noun - A number of persons or things that are grouped together because they have something in common.
Usage example: I prefer jackets with zippers to the sort that close with buttons

Species
Species noun - One of the units into which a whole is divided on the basis of a common characteristic.
Usage example: a music that is now generally regarded as a distinct species of rap
